When We Question God’s Power

01/11/2024

Whether we’re shopping for a car or a computer, we typically ask, “How powerful is it?” Why do we ask? We want to know if what we’re considering buying can do what we want and need.

We may not say or even realize it, but sometimes we may question God’s power. For example, we pray about something and then we worry.

If we really believed that nothing is impossible with God, then worry wouldn’t have a place in our lives.

Today is a good day to remember 1 Chronicles 29:11, that God is all powerful and we can confidently place our trust in Him. “Yours, O LORD, is the greatness and the power and the glory and the victory and the majesty, indeed everything that is in the heavens and the earth; Yours is the dominion, O LORD, and You exalt Yourself as head over all.”

Let that be our prayer. Let that be our mindset as we live out our day.

“Lord, You are great, ALL POWERERFUL, and the One to whom glory, victory, and majesty belong. Help us walk out our faith and belief and trust in You today rather than fret over details.”
